Elizabeth City Chamber News<br />

by: Holly Staples<br />

We had a record crowd at our 9th Annual Women of Excellence Awards<br />

Luncheon on June 19! Twenty very deserving nominees were honored,<br />

while five winners were named. Our winners are: Amber Davis, principal of<br />

Camden County High School and Camden Early College High School; Norma<br />

James, Broker-In -Charge at Taylor Mueller Realty; Rhonda James-Davis,<br />

Career and Technical Education Director and Interim Superintendent at Elizabeth<br />

City-Pasquotank Public Schools; Rachel Reddick, church and community<br />

volunteer; and Dena Richardson, Interim Fire Marshal for the City of Elizabeth<br />

City. These women were honored for going above and beyond in their careers<br />

and in their service to the community.<br />

A big thank you to event sponsor Piedmont Natural Gas, and to our hosts<br />

at The Carolina Center at Corporate Drive for providing a wonderful setting.<br />

<strong>Albemarle</strong> Floral supplied roses for the nominees, Margaret Twiford provided<br />

beautiful table centerpieces, and Shaklee-Gwen Bell provided goody bags.<br />

Thanks so much to the Women of Excellence Committee, nominators, honorees,<br />

and attendees!<br />

The Elizabeth City/Pasquotank County Parks and<br />

Recreation Department is proud to bring you the<br />

Downtown Waterfront Market. This market is held<br />

every Saturday from June 1st-August 31st, <strong>2019</strong>. The<br />

hours of the market are 9am-1pm and is held in the<br />

heart of the Elizabeth City waterfront, Mariners’ Wharf<br />

Park.<br />

Each week different vendors come to showcase their<br />

handmade talents and homemade/homegrown products.<br />

Be it the farmer with the fresh produce, eggs, or<br />

raw honey or the one selling microgreens and black<br />

garlic. We have beautiful, unique handmade jewelry<br />

pieces that you will not find anywhere else. Vendors<br />

make all natural, handmade soaps, body lotions, hair<br />

care products, and beauty masks. Also for sell are<br />

homemade doggie treats, fresh baked items, and sunscreen<br />

and bug spray made from nothing but all natural,<br />

pure ingredients. Stop by and grab a handmade<br />

whirligig or homemade barbeque and hot sauces.<br />

Besides these vendors, each week different nonprofit<br />

agencies are spotlighted at the market. These<br />

vendors provide information, raffles, food and drinks,<br />

crafts and so much more.<br />
